Choose the Right Setup Before You Install
Before attaching anything to the windshield, decide how you want the camera powered. Most dash cameras use one of three options: a 12V outlet adapter, a hardwire kit, or a rearview mirror power adapter.
A 12V outlet adapter is usually the fastest option. It is a good choice for drivers who want a straightforward setup, may move the camera between vehicles, or prefer not to work with the fuse box. The trade-off is that the cord may be more visible, and your vehicle's outlet may remain occupied.
A hardwire kit creates a cleaner, more permanent look. It connects the dash camera to the vehicle's fuse box and can support parking-mode recording when paired with a compatible camera. This option takes more care because an incorrect connection can drain the battery or affect a circuit. If you are not comfortable identifying fuses and checking voltage, professional installation is a sensible choice.
A rearview mirror power adapter can be a practical middle ground in compatible vehicles. It draws power from the mirror assembly, so there is little to no visible cable. Compatibility varies by make, model, and mirror type, so verify the adapter before ordering.
Where to Mount a Dash Camera
For a front-facing camera, the best mounting location is generally high on the windshield, behind or just to the passenger side of the rearview mirror. This position gives the camera a wide view of the road without creating a distraction for the driver.
Keep the lens outside the windshield wipers' blind spots. A camera can be mounted securely and still produce poor footage if rain, snow, or grime regularly block its view. Before removing the adhesive backing, sit in the driver's seat and check whether the camera will interfere with your line of sight.
Avoid placing the camera over sensors, tint bands, or areas with embedded heating elements. Many newer vehicles have forward-facing safety equipment near the mirror, including cameras and collision-warning sensors. Do not block these components or force a mount into a tight space around them.
Clean the Glass First
Adhesive mounts work best on clean, dry glass. Wipe the mounting area with glass cleaner, then use an alcohol wipe to remove any remaining oils or residue. Let the surface dry completely before applying the mount.
Once the adhesive touches the windshield, it may be difficult to reposition without weakening it. Hold the camera in place first, confirm the viewing angle, and then press the mount firmly for the amount of time recommended by its manufacturer.
How to Route the Power Cable Safely
A loose cable across the windshield or dashboard is more than an appearance issue. It can distract the driver, snag during cleaning, or get in the way of controls. Tucking the cable along the headliner and door trim usually creates the cleanest result.
Start at the camera and gently guide the cable into the gap between the headliner and windshield. Continue toward the passenger-side A-pillar, then down toward the glove box area or center console. A plastic trim tool is useful here because it helps tuck the cable without scratching interior panels.
Take special care around the A-pillar. Many vehicles have side-curtain airbags behind this trim. Do not run the cable across an airbag path or wrap it around airbag hardware. Instead, keep the wire toward the windshield side of the trim or follow the vehicle manual's guidance. When in doubt, stop and ask an installer for help.
From the lower dash, route the cable to the chosen power source. Leave a small amount of slack near the camera so you can adjust its angle, but avoid coiling excess wire where it may interfere with pedals, the steering column, or glove box operation. Secure any remaining length with small cable clips or ties in an out-of-the-way spot.
Set the Camera Angle for Useful Footage
After the dash camera installation is complete, turn the camera on and check its live view. The road should fill most of the frame, with a small portion of the hood visible at the bottom. Including a little of the hood helps show the camera's orientation, but too much reduces the useful view of traffic ahead.
Aim the camera level with the horizon. If it points too high, it may capture mostly sky and miss details such as license plates. If it points too low, it may lose important activity farther down the road. A few minutes spent checking the angle in daylight is worth it.
If your camera includes a rear-facing unit, mount it where it can see through the rear glass without being blocked by headrests, cargo, or a rear wiper. SUVs, hatchbacks, and vehicles with deeply angled rear windows may need a slightly different placement than sedans. Test the view before permanently securing the cable.
Use the Right Settings From Day One
A dash camera is only as helpful as the footage it saves. Insert a quality, high-endurance microSD card that is designed for frequent recording. Standard memory cards can wear out faster because dash cameras constantly write and overwrite video files.
Set the date, time, and time zone correctly. Accurate timestamps matter if footage is needed for an insurance claim or to document an incident. Check that loop recording is enabled so the camera automatically overwrites older, non-protected clips when storage becomes full.
Many cameras also offer sensitivity settings for the G-sensor, which locks footage when it detects an impact. A setting that is too sensitive may lock files every time you hit a pothole. A setting that is too low may miss a meaningful impact. Start with the middle setting, then adjust after a week of normal driving.
If you use parking mode, understand the battery trade-off. Parking recording can be valuable for hit-and-runs or vandalism, but it requires a hardwire kit with low-voltage protection or another dedicated power solution. That protection shuts the camera off before the vehicle battery falls too low to start the engine.
Test It Before You Rely on It
Do not wait until an incident to learn that the camera was not recording. Take a short drive, then review a few clips on the camera or its app. Check video clarity, sound if you use audio recording, date and time, and whether the camera starts automatically with the vehicle.
Review the footage again at night. Headlight glare, dashboard reflections, and a poorly aimed lens are easier to spot after dark. If reflections are a problem, move the camera slightly higher, lower the dashboard brightness, and keep the windshield clean inside and out.
It is also smart to check the memory card every month or two. Format it using the camera's built-in formatting option when recommended by the manufacturer, and replace it if recordings become unreliable or the camera shows card errors.
A Few Legal and Privacy Considerations
Dash camera laws can vary by state, especially around windshield obstructions and audio recording. Mount the unit where it does not block your view, and check local rules if you record conversations inside the vehicle. Some states require consent from everyone involved before audio can be recorded.
Use footage responsibly, too. A dash camera can help document an accident, road hazard, or parking damage, but it does not replace safe driving or proper insurance coverage. If you are involved in a collision, focus first on getting to safety and following the appropriate reporting steps.
